Community Benefits for an Inclusive Recovery

Artwork courtesy of Toronto Community Benefits Network

The federal government is planning to invest over $187 billion in infrastructure projects across Canada in the next 10 years. Twenty-nine organizations have come together in a campaign for an  Inclusive Recovery  that calls on the government to leverage Community Benefits Agreements as a part of these projects. This means the money could do ‘double duty’ by creating local job and business opportunities for Black and Indigenous peoples, women, persons with disabilities, veterans, youth and newcomers.
